The genius of the #MeToo awareness campaign was its lack of intermediaries. There were no press releases from non-profits at the start. There were just two words on a screen, followed by millions of paragraphs of survivor testimony. The campaign succeeded because it solved a critical problem: isolation. Survivors of sexual assault and harassment had spent years believing they were anomalies. By reading the stories of others—famous actors, restaurant servers, factory workers—they realized the "anomaly" was actually a systemic epidemic. The Psychology of the "Story" Many campaigns focus
